Web先序遍历过程. a. 访问 根节点 ;. b. 先序遍历其左子树;. c. 先序遍历其右子树;. 然后就是一直递归下去,在访问到节点的时候,可以进行节点的相关处理,比如说简单的访问节点值. 下图是一棵二叉树,我们来手动模拟一下 … WebNov 23, 2024 · 二叉树的前序遍历. 在不使用递归的方式遍历二叉树时,我们可以使用一个栈模拟递归的机制。. 二叉树的前序遍历顺序是:根 → 左子树 → 右子树,我们可以先将 …
C_Language/Date23_4_1_ExperimentCourseBinaryTree.cpp at …
WebAug 7, 2024 ·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Web对于链表存储的二叉树,递归实现先序遍历二叉树的 c 语言代码为 void PreOrderTraverse(BiTree T) { //如果二叉树存在,则遍历二叉树 if (T) { printf("%d",T … 本节给出的都是实现中序遍历的 c 语言关键代码,对于中序遍历顺序表中存储的完 … grantstown laois
树的遍历之先序遍历二叉树 - 数据结构教程 - C语言网
Web33. 本词条由 “科普中国”科学百科词条编写与应用工作项目 审核 。. 后序遍历(LRD)是 二叉树遍历 的一种,也叫做 后根遍历 、后序周游,可记做左右根。. 后序遍历有 递归算法 和非递归算法两种。. 在二叉树中,先左后右再根,即首先遍历左子树,然后遍历 ... WebMar 28, 2024 · 遍历方法一般有四种: 先序遍历 、 中序遍历 、后序遍历及层次遍历,其中,前三种一般使用深度优先搜索 (DFS)实现。. 无论是这三种遍历中的哪一种,左子树一 … Web前言. 说到树的四种遍历方式,可能大家第一时间都会想到它的四种遍历方式,并快速说了它的特点。. 接着当你要手动写代码的时候,你写得出来嘛?. 1. 递归实现二叉树的前序,中序,后续遍历 2. 非递归二叉树的实现前序,中序,后续遍历 3. 实现二叉树的层 ... grant straw #ss81668140 grcm